Droppings and Pee
If you see droppings and urine in your home, it's critical to deal with the concern right away to avoid more rodent invasion.
Rats, such as computer mice and rats, can bring dangerous conditions that can be transmitted through their droppings and pee. These bugs leave feces and urine as they move around your house, looking for food and nesting materials.
The visibility of droppings and urine not only suggests a present infestation however also draws in more rats to your home. These waste products contain scents that indicate to other rodents that your home is an ideal environment.
To successfully remove the problem, clean up the droppings and urine utilizing appropriate protective equipment and anti-bacterial. Additionally, seal any type of entry indicate stop re-entry and eliminate possible food and water sources.
Gnaw Marks and Chewed Materials
Gnaw marks and ate materials are clear indicators of a rodent invasion in your house. If read full article discover these dead giveaways, it's important to take instant action to eliminate the issue.
Here are 4 reasons why you must be concerned about gnaw marks and ate products:
1. Property damage: Rats have solid teeth that are regularly expanding. As a result, they gnaw on different items in your home, including electric cables, timber, plastic, and even metal pipelines. This can bring about expensive repair services and potential security dangers.
2. Health and wellness threats: Rats typically bring illness that can be transferred to people with their pee, droppings, and saliva. Their gnawing can also contaminate your food, making you and your family members vulnerable to foodborne illnesses.
3. Architectural stability: Continuous gnawing on structure products can compromise the structure of your home, jeopardizing its stability. This can position a severe threat to your safety and security and the worth of your residential or commercial property.
4. Psychological distress: Sharing your space with rats can cause significant stress and anxiety. The consistent existence of these pests and the damage they trigger can interrupt your daily life and make you really feel uneasy in your own home.
Weird Noises and Smells
When taking care of a rodent invasion, it is necessary to be familiar with unusual noises and odors in your home. These signs can indicate the presence of rats and should not be ignored.
If you hear scraping, scampering, or squealing audios coming from your walls, ceilings, or floors, it's likely that rats are present. https://how-to-remove-rats-from-a17395.dailyblogzz.com/33950976/historic-building-maintains-charm-and-security-with-effective-termite-monitoring-methods , so these noises are more probable to be heard during the night.
Furthermore, solid and undesirable odors can be a telltale sign of a rodent infestation. Rodents have scent glands that generate a musky scent, and their urine and droppings can discharge a strong, foul odor.
If you notice any unusual noises or odors, it's critical to take instant action to resolve the rodent invasion and protect against more damages to your home.
